Classified advertising is that advertising which is grouped in certain sections of the paper and is thus distinguished from display advertising. Such【B1】______as "Help Wanted", "Re al Estate," "Lost and Found" are made, the rate【B2】______being less than that for display advertising. Classified advertisements are a【B3】______to the reader and a saving to the advertiser. The reader who is interested in a【B4】______kind of advertisement finds all advertisements of that type grouped for him. The advertiser may, on this account, use a very small advertisement that would be lost if it were placed among larger advertisements in the paper.
It is【B5】______that the reader approaches the classified advertisement in a different frame of mind from that in which he【B6】______the other advertisements in the paper. He turns to a page of classified advertisements to search for the particular advertisement that will meet his needs. As his attention is【B7】______, the advertiser does not need to【B8】______very much on display type to get the reader’s attention.
